NIOBIUM ALLOY

An alloy formed by adding several elements to niobium as the base, is an important refractory metal material. It mainly includes niobium hafnium alloy, niobium tungsten alloy, niobium zirconium alloy, niobium titanium alloy, niobium tungsten hafnium alloy, niobium tantalum tungsten alloy and niobium titanium aluminum alloy. Niobium alloy usually maintains the low-temperature plasticity of pure niobium, and has much higher strength and other properties than pure niobium. Among the tungsten, molybdenum, tantalum and niobium refractory metal materials, niobium alloy has the highest specific strength.


PRODUCT USES

1. Manufacture of aircraft engine parts and gas turbine blades.

2. Nuclear fuel jacket materials, nuclear fuel alloys and heat exchanger structural materials in the atomic energy industry.

3. Manufacture of rocket engines, satellites, spacecraft and missiles in the aerospace field. Components such as the thrust chamber body extension of the attitude control/orbit control engine.

4. High-tech fields such as electronics, metallurgy, steel, chemical industry, cemented carbide, atomic energy, superconducting technology, automotive electronics, aerospace, medical and health care and scientific research.

5. Manufacture of tantalum capacitors.
